What is element quality in meshing?

The mesh element quality is a dimensionless quantity between 0 and 1, where 1 represents a perfectly regular element, in the chosen quality measure, and 0 represents a degenerated element.

What is a good mesh quality ANSYS?

A good rule of thumb is that the maximum skewness for tetrahedral cells should less be than 0.95. The maximum cell squish index for all types of cells should be less than 0.99. Cell size change and face warp are additional quality measure that could affect stability and accuracy.

What is a good mesh quality?

A good-quality mesh has an Aspect ratio less than 5 for most of its elements (90% and above). Create a Mesh Quality Plot to plot the Aspect ratio of all elements.

What is a good orthogonal quality in ANSYS?

Regarding minimum orthogonal quality, the best practice is to keep the minimum value above 0.1. If you visually inspect these cells with lower than the quality threshold, these cells are squished – which is not good for the Fluent solver. This is just a rule of thumb to obtain better-converged results.

How do I know if my mesh is good enough?

The most basic and accurate way to evaluate mesh quality is to refine the mesh until a critical result such as the maximum stress in a specific location converges: meaning that it doesn’t change significantly as the mesh is a refinement.

What is orthogonality in CFD?

Orthogonality. The concept of mesh orthogonality relates to how close the angles between adjacent element faces (or adjacent element edges) are to some optimal angle (depending on the relevant topology). An example for orthogonality is presented as in ANSYS Fluent in the figure below.

What makes a good mesh CFD?

In CFD problems, regions with high flow velocity gradient or in boundary layers near curved surfaces are good candidates for higher mesh density, as these regions may require higher accuracy.
